Eurico’s debut EP [Chokehold] combines experimental soundscapes with sharp social commentary. The title track uses layered vocal manipulation and fragmented rhythms to critique surveillance culture. ‘Faceless’ delivers hard-hitting drums and industrial noise, addressing labor and identity under modern systems. ‘Forced Adoption’ introduces melodic, ethereal bells to explore themes of colonial legacy, while ‘Render’ closes with dark, ambient textures that create a shadowy, introspective atmosphere.
Eurico is a Portugal-born, Amsterdam-based artist, producer, DJ and cultural organizer working with language, code, and the intersections of human experience. They founded Soort, an independent music label, co-founded Big Toilet Radio, and is a member of the Caixa Cartão Collective.
